首先,咱们得先理解到底什么是加密数字货币。简单来说,加密数字货币就是使用加密技术来保障交易安全的一种虚拟货币。比特币是最著名的例子,但现在市面上有成千上万种不同的加密货币。想开发自己的加密数字货币,得先对区块链技术有个基本的认识。
区块链是一个分布式的账本技术,每一笔交易都会被记录在多个节点上,确保透明和安全。这就像是大家一起记账,每个人都有一份账本,大家的账本都一致,想造假基本上不可能。
在动手之前,问问自己:你想开发什么类型的加密货币?是为了解决某个问题,还是纯粹想搞个新玩意儿?不同的目标会影响你的开发方向。例如,有的人开发代币是为了给自己的项目筹款,有的人则是为了提供某种服务。
考虑一些问题,比如这款货币有什么实际应用?它的目标用户是谁?在现有的市场上是否已经有类似的产品?这些都是在开发前需要认真思考的。
接下来,选择适合你的技术架构。如果你决定创建一种全新的加密货币,通常需要底层的区块链技术。比如,用以太坊的框架,或者直接用比特币的源码进行修改,这都可以是不错的选择。
如果你不想从头开始,也可以选择创建“代币”,它是基于现有的区块链,比如以太坊,简单些且更省事,你只需发布智能合约就可以。这样,你可以利用现有的区块链功能,节约不少开发时间和成本。
该写代码了,鼓起勇气吧!如果你对编程有一定的基础,编写智能合约并不是件难事。以以太坊为例,你可以使用Solidity这样的编程语言来编写。对于初学者来说,这有点学习曲线,但网上有很多教程,慢慢来,总能学会。
如果编程对你来说是一门外语,找个开发团队或者合伙人也是个不错的选择。在这方面找个靠谱的人一起合作,不仅能提高效率,也能帮助你更好地理解技术细节。
别急着上线,测试真的是一个重要步骤!就像是新车上路前需要检测一样,你的加密货币也需要经过详尽的测试。找一些志同道合的朋友全部试一遍,看看在不同环境、不同操作下它的表现如何。
如果条件允许,找专业的第三方进行安全审计,确保没有漏洞。这可直接关系到你项目的信誉和安全性。毕竟,才刚开始就被黑客攻击,那就尴尬了。
测试完毕,一切准备就绪,可以发布啦!但发布之后,你还得让人知道你的加密货币。推广这块也是个大工程。社交媒体、论坛、甚至一些相关的活动,都是宣传的好机会。线上线下结合会更有效。
可以考虑进行空投(Airdrop)或者其他形式的推广活动,让大家能够方便地了解和使用你的货币。记得,建立社区非常重要,用户能参与到其中,也能提升对你项目的忠诚度。
上线之后并不是就结束了,你还得持续关注项目的发展和用户反馈。保持和社区的互动,及时回应他们的问题和建议。这样才能不断改进你的产品,让它越来越好。
同时,定期进行技术更新和安全维护,确保你的平台始终安全、稳定。技术的更新换代是快的,跟上趟才能让你的加密货币不被淘汰。
开发加密货币并不是一蹴而就的事情,里面有着很多挑战。之前提到的只是一些基本流程,真正操作起来时会遇到多种问题。比如,合规,这可是个棘手的问题。各国对加密货币的监管政策不一,你得提前了解可能遇到的法律问题,以免后期把自己搞得麻烦。
另外,市场竞争也挺激烈的,想做到脱颖而出,可得多动脑筋。不过只要你有明确的目标与规划,加上坚持不懈的努力,也不是没有可能。
说真的,开发加密数字货币的过程就像烹饪一道复杂的菜。一开始你可能觉得无从下手,后来通过学习和动手实践,慢慢找到窍门。一道菜的好坏看的是制作过程中的每一个细节,亲力亲为就是那么重要。
无论你的目标是什么,保持好奇和学习的心态,时时刻刻关注行业动态和市场变化。这场仗不是一蹴而就的,享受这个过程,才是最珍贵的!希望大家在这条路上越走越顺,开发出让人惊艳的加密货币!
leave a reply